    Fridge Freezers For Sale

    Refrigerator freezers come in many different styles. They can be put in your cabinets and include various fancy features such as through-the-door water and drawers specifically designed for things like cheese, eggs or fruit.

    There are also innovative water dispensers which shut off automatically once your pitcher or glass runs out.

    Side-by-Side

    The classic fridge with the freezer on top has largely been replaced by models that have side-by-side compartments which provide the same amount of refrigerator and freezer space. These fridges use shelves instead of drawers to store food, and are available in a variety sizes and finishes to ensure that you can find the ideal one for your kitchen's size and design.

    If you plan to place your new refrigerator next to a stove it is recommended to leave an area of 12 inches between them to ensure security and efficiency. If you must place the appliances closer together, insulation or similar foam could help prevent heat transfers between them and protect the fridge from the intense heat produced by the burners. You should also avoid having the door of your refrigerator block the opening of the stove or oven when you're cooking. This can cause a fire risk and make it difficult to use the appliances safely.

    Bottom Freezer

    Located at the eye level, refrigerator freezers are very popular with elderly individuals and those with mobility issues who wish to reduce the amount of bending they need to do in order to access the contents of their fridge. They are also great for families with kids since it's easier for children to reach for ice from the freezer compartment without having to bend or reach.

    Bottom freezer refrigerators are different from the older models with the freezer compartment at the top. They have a pull-out drawer that allows you organize and store food in various ways. They offer more freezer space than top-mounted units too which makes them a great choice for people who shop regularly or host large family meals regularly.

    They're also more efficient in terms of energy consumption than older fridge freezers that have the freezer on the top. This is due to the fact that warmer air naturally flows into the freezer section and could hinder cooling, but newer refrigerators with bottom freezers feature dual evaporator systems which separate the two sections, so there's no crossover of warm air.

    Bottom-mount refrigerators have a slimmer profile than their top mount counterparts. This makes them a desirable option for contemporary kitchens because they'll appear seamless in your kitchen. They're also available in various designs, so you'll be able to find the perfect match for your kitchen's overall decor.

    They're a great addition to your kitchen and offer ample space for storage of frozen food items. They are smaller and require less space than chest freezers, so they're ideal for smaller or medium-sized kitchens, basements or garages. They also come with features that make them easier to use with, like an external temperature control system, as well as a stay-open lid.

    Many upright freezers also come with a variety of organizational features that will help you organize your food items efficiently. This includes door storage bins, adjustable shelving, dividers, and compartments to hold items like frozen dinners, packages of meat or other produce. It will save you from eating food waste and needing to hunt for specific items whenever you need them. They also make cleaning your freezer easier.

    You can find upright freezers in a variety of sizes, based on the requirements of your. The larger models can store large quantities of food or meat for a family meal. Smaller upright freezers with less capacity are ideal for singles who do not require the space for large items or for a couple that lives on their own and only will use the freezer for small leftovers or convenience foods.

    The savings in electricity can be realized by selecting energy efficient models for both upright and chest freezers. Find an appliance that has an energy STAR label to ensure it is in compliance with strict energy efficiency specifications.
